Output 73b08ba73c7e3aaf7e58288fc652c9d9850e1b5bab7e73020f5c0a6d35a36325:0

value
2480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703044390b1183dfbe95147eb45c1586a7b169e1 OP_EQUAL
address
3BvDReHWReFfwtLeiQ7CMrvC2Jr834Tx4e
transaction
73b08ba73c7e3aaf7e58288fc652c9d9850e1b5bab7e73020f5c0a6d35a36325
spent
true